Chapter: Hajj
كتاب الحج
Arabic Text
وَعَنْ أَنَسٍ - رضى الله عنه - { أَنَّ اَلنَّبِيَّ - صلى الله عليه وسلم -صَلَّى اَلظُّهْرَ وَالْعَصْرَ وَالْمَغْرِبَ وَالْعِشَاءَ, ثُمَّ رَقَدَ رَقْدَةً بِالْمُحَصَّبِ, ثُمَّ رَكِبَ إِلَى اَلْبَيْتِ فَطَافَ بِهِ } رَوَاهُ اَلْبُخَارِيُّ. 1 .1 - صحيح. رواه البخاري ( 1764 ).
English Translation
Anas (RAA), narrated, 'the Messenger of Allah ﷺ rested for a while at al-Muhassab (a valley opening at al-Abtah between Makkah and Mina) prayed Dhuhr, Asr, Maghrib and 'Isha prayers after which he rode to the Ka’bah and made Tawaf.’ Related by Al·Bukhari.
